Abstract

305,156. Saccaggio, P. C. Nov. 1, 1927. Controlling motors by varying terminal voltage; controllers, actuating, restraining, and locking.- In controlling a traction motor b, Fig. 1, by varying the field resistance d of an engine-driven generator a, the control member f, which may be a handle, or a servo device, is associated with a notched quadrant h<1> linked to a speed governor g, for the purpose of automatically adjusting the range of control to the rate at which the vehicle is travelling. In the modification shown in Fig. 2 the quadrant is linked to a floating lever q operated conjointly by two speed-governors, one on the driving shaft, the other on the generator shaft, for the purpose of allowing for irregularity of engine speed. The hand-lever f can be freed from constraint by pressing a trigger n, the same pressure breaking the power transmission circuit at a switch e. The trigger mechanism is arranged so that the switch e cannot be released until the handle f is brought within its original vange of movement
